使用python绘制一朵郁金香
时间: 2023-03-20 16:02:22 浏览: 233
你可以使用matplotlib库在python中绘制一朵郁金香。
首先,你需要导入matplotlib库,然后使用其中的函数来绘制各种图形,最后使用显示图形的函数来显示出来。
这是一个简单的代码示例:
```
import matplotlib.pyplot as plt
import numpy as np
t = np.arange(0, 2 * np.pi, 0.1)
x = 16 * np.sin(t)**3
y = 13 * np.cos(t) - 5 * np.cos(2 * t) - 2 * np.cos(3 * t) - np.cos(4 * t)
plt.plot(x, y)
plt.show()
```
这样,你就可以绘制一朵郁金香了。
相关问题
使用python绘制一朵漂亮的花
以下是使用Python的Turtle库绘制一朵漂亮的花的示例代码:
```python
import turtle
# 设置画布和画笔
canvas = turtle.Screen()
canvas.bgcolor("black")
pen = turtle.Turtle()
pen.speed(0)
pen.color("white")
# 绘制花朵
for i in range(10):
pen.circle(100)
pen.right(36)
# 绘制花瓣
for i in range(20):
pen.penup()
pen.setposition(0, 0)
pen.pendown()
pen.left(i * 18)
pen.forward(200)
pen.right(90)
pen.forward(20)
pen.right(90)
pen.forward(20)
pen.right(90)
pen.forward(20)
pen.right(90)
pen.forward(200)
# 隐藏画笔
pen.hideturtle()
# 关闭画布
canvas.exitonclick()
```
运行上述代码,将会绘制出一朵漂亮的花。你可以根据自己的喜好调整花朵和花瓣的颜色和大小。
帮我使用python绘制一朵玫瑰花
好的,我可以为您提供一个使用 Python 绘制玫瑰花的代码,使用了 Python 的绘图库 `turtle`。
代码如下:
```python
import turtle
# 设置画布大小和背景色
turtle.setup(800, 800)
turtle.bgcolor("black")
# 定义画笔的颜色和粗细
turtle.color("red", "pink")
turtle.pensize(3)
# 定义画玫瑰花的函数
def draw_rose():
turtle.speed(0)
for i in range(200):
turtle.right(1)
turtle.forward(2)
turtle.pensize(i/100)
turtle.left(1)
turtle.speed(5)
turtle.left(70)
turtle.forward(200)
turtle.right(110)
turtle.forward(200)
turtle.speed(0)
for i in range(20):
turtle.right(1)
turtle.forward(2)
turtle.pensize(i/10)
turtle.left(1)
# 调用函数画玫瑰花
draw_rose()
# 隐藏画笔
turtle.hideturtle()
# 点击关闭窗口
turtle.done()
```
运行这段代码后,将会在窗口中绘制一朵玫瑰花,效果如下图所示:
![rose](https://cdn.jsdelivr.net/gh/Yikun/hugo-blog/content/images/2021-05-11-python-rose.png)